Resplendent in British Racing Green the Aston Martin DB2 Mk III saloon, a colour which is so complimentary to the bodyshape, our model is registered WYE 847. Internal detail is amazing, with beige front and rear seating, tan steering wheel - even the glove box has a tan finish - and black dashboard, complete with detailed instrument panel with silver surrounds to the dial rims. The 'carpets' are brown. Externally, the wheels and the distinctive Aston Martin radiator grille are both given a silver finish.
In real life, the Aston Martin DB Mark III, was classed as a sports car which the British company made between 1957 and 1959, with only 551 being produced, ensuring its exclusivity. One could buy it as a 2 + 2 hatchback, 2-seater coupe? or 2-seater drophead. The Mark III was the first model to sport the new radiator grille which would become the hallmark of all Astons from then on. The DBIII also featured another first in its design evolution - a sloping hatchback body.
This iconic new addition to our Oxford Automobiles series will no doubt please fans of classic cars of the 1950s-1960s but will also appeal in a looser sense to James Bond OO7 fans who may have read Ian Fleming's book 'Goldfinger' in which Bond drives a DB Mark III, though not this one we should add!
